### High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T)

High-Intensity Interval Training, or HIIT, has gained popularity in recent years for its ability to burn a significant amount of calories in a short amount of time. HIIT involves alternating between short bursts of intense exercise and brief periods of rest or lower-intensity exercise. This type of workout keeps your heart rate elevated and boosts your metabolism, leading to greater fat burn both during and after the workout. HIIT workouts can be tailored to your fitness level and preferences, making them a versatile option for anyone looking to torch fat efficiently.

### Running or Jogging

Running or jogging is a classic cardio workout that is not only effective for burning fat but also improving endurance and stamina. Whether you prefer running outdoors or on a treadmill, this high-impact exercise can help you burn a significant amount of calories and elevate your heart rate. To maximize fat burn, consider incorporating interval training into your running routine by alternating between sprints and recovery periods. Running or jogging regularly can help you increase your cardiovascular fitness and achieve your weight loss goals.

### Cycling

Cycling is another excellent cardio workout that can help you burn fat while being easy on the joints. Whether you choose to ride outdoors or use a stationary bike, cycling can provide a challenging workout that targets your lower body muscles and engages your core. By adjusting the resistance or speed, you can customize your cycling workout to increase the intensity and maximize calorie burn. Cycling is a great option for individuals of all fitness levels looking to improve their cardiovascular health and lose weight.

### Jump Rope

Jumping rope is a simple yet effective cardio workout that can help you torch fat and improve coordination and agility. This high-intensity exercise engages multiple muscle groups and elevates your heart rate quickly, making it a great option for a quick and efficient fat-burning workout. Jump rope workouts can easily be modified to suit your fitness level by adjusting the speed or incorporating different jump rope techniques. Adding jump rope sessions to your fitness routine can help you increase your calorie burn and boost your metabolism.

### Swimming

Swimming is a low-impact cardio workout that provides a full-body workout while burning a significant amount of calories. Whether you swim laps in a pool or take a water aerobics class, swimming can help you improve cardiovascular endurance and strengthen your muscles. The resistance of the water adds an extra challenge to your workout, making it an effective fat-burning exercise. Swimming is a great option for individuals with joint pain or injuries looking for a low-impact yet effective cardio workout.

### Rowing

Rowing is a total-body cardio workout that targets multiple muscle groups while providing a high-intensity calorie burn. Whether you use a rowing machine at the gym or row outdoors, this full-body exercise can help you improve cardiovascular fitness and burn fat efficiently. Rowing engages your legs, core, and upper body, making it a challenging yet rewarding workout option. By adjusting the resistance and speed, you can tailor your rowing workout to match your fitness level and fat-burning goals.
